"Reduction of inflammatory signaling" is **not** the name of a specific molecule or receptor. Instead, it refers to the general process or therapeutic strategy aimed at decreasing activity within one or more cellular pathways that mediate inflammation. These include well-characterized intracellular cascades such as the **NF-kappa B**, **MAP kinase**, and **JAK/STAT** pathways[1][2][4]. Therapeutic reduction can be achieved by targeting key receptors like Toll-like receptors (TLRs), cytokine receptors for interleukin‑1β, interleukin‑6, tumor necrosis factor-alpha—and their downstream effectors—using small molecules or biologics[5]. This approach is central in treating diseases where excessive inflammation drives pathology—including autoimmune disorders, cancer progression/resistance to therapy[3], cardiovascular diseases, and severe infections marked by cytokine storms[8]. However, because "reduction of inflammatory signaling" does not refer to any single gene product/protein/receptor/enzyme/transcription factor/etc., it cannot be classified as a canonical therapeutic target. Instead it describes an outcome that may be achieved through intervention at multiple possible nodes within complex immune/inflammatory networks. In summary: this entry is incorrect as a molecular target because it lacks specificity—it describes an effect rather than an actionable biological entity.
